- Florida Governor Ron DeSantis said the state is seriously considering filing charges tied to drug smuggling and the alleged sending of released prisoners to the United States, including members of Tren de Aragua.
- DeSantis indicated any case would run through the state attorney general and could be brought in Miami, noting this would be separate from federal proceedings.
- China’s Foreign Ministry said Venezuela holds full sovereignty over its natural resources and condemned U.S. actions as serious violations of international law.
- According to Venezuela’s foreign ministry, UN Secretary‑General António Guterres affirmed the country’s permanent sovereignty over its resources and described the U.S. operation as a grave breach of the UN Charter.
- Spain’s foreign minister said Venezuela’s natural resources belong to its people and warned the U.S. operation sets a dangerous precedent, while Caracas pressed regional bodies for an institutional response.
